§ 307. Qualified historical and archaeological societies.
Any historical or archaeological society in this Commonwealth
shall be deemed to be a qualified historical or archaeological
society if it:
(1) Has at least 100 paid members, has been organized at
least two years and has been incorporated as a corporation
not-for-profit.
(2) Holds at least one public meeting annually at which
papers are read or discussions held on historical or
archaeological subjects.
(3) Has adopted a constitution and bylaws and has
elected proper officers to conduct its business.
(4) Has either established a museum or library in which
books, documents, papers and other objects of historical and
cultural interest are deposited or has made periodic
publications totaling at least 25 pages each year relating to
the history of this Commonwealth or of the area in which the
society is located.
